Cinematic Conflict Course Overview
This course on 'Cinematic Conflict' is designed for professionals who are keen to master the art of creating engaging narratives through effective conflict. The course delves deep into understanding the various types of conflict in cinema, their impact on the storyline, and how they can be effectively used to enhance the overall narrative. The course covers both theoretical concepts and practical applications, providing a holistic learning experience. The course also emphasizes the importance of conflict in character development, plot progression, and audience engagement. The concepts taught in this course are not exclusive to cinema but can be applied to any form of storytelling, making this course highly beneficial for professionals across industries. By the end of this course, you will be equipped with the skills to create compelling narratives that captivate the audience and leave a lasting impact.

Course Content

Module 1: Introduction to Cinematic Conflict

This module focuses on understanding the concept of conflict in cinema and its importance in storytelling.

Key Topics Covered:

Definition of conflict
Role of conflict in storytelling
Types of conflict in cinema
Examples of conflict in popular films

Module 2: Creating Conflict

This module delves into the art of creating different types of conflict and using them effectively in storytelling.

Key Topics Covered:

Creating internal conflict
Creating external conflict
Creating societal conflict
Creating conflict between characters

Module 3: Conflict and Character Development

This module focuses on how conflict can be used for effective character development.

Key Topics Covered:

Role of conflict in character development
Creating character arcs with conflict
Conflict and character transformation
Case studies of character development using conflict

Module 4: Conflict and Plot Progression

This module explores how conflict drives plot progression and maintains audience engagement.

Key Topics Covered:

Conflict as a plot device
Creating plot twists with conflict
Maintaining tension and suspense with conflict
Case studies of plot progression using conflict

Module 5: Practical Applications of Cinematic Conflict

This module provides practical exercises and examples for applying the principles of cinematic conflict.

Key Topics Covered:

Scriptwriting exercises
Analyzing conflict in scripts
Creating engaging narratives with conflict
Peer review of scripts
